> > Hierarchical IRQ domains can be used to stack different IRQ controllers
> > on top of each other. One specific use-case where this can be useful is
> > if a power management controller has top-level controls for wakeup
> > interrupts. In such cases, the power management controller can be a
> > parent to other interrupt controllers and program additional registers
> > when an IRQ has its wake capability enabled or disabled.
